Household of Pieter Pieterszn 't Hart

He is married to Bregje Hendriksdr de Jongh.

They got married on April 28, 1697 at 's-Gravenzande, Nederland, he was 28 years old.


Child(ren):

  1. Johannes Jacob 't Hart  1710-????
